This hotel is amazing. It is not in the first row to Niagara Falls, however, it view of the falls. Our room was on the 27. Floor. Actually we had booked city-view, but we asked the front desk to, whether it would be a falls-view room. Well, we were there at the beginning of January and the hotel was not fully booked. The concierge gave us a room for the same price with if-view. It was a suite, which he gave us! We had a large couch with table, a Jacuzzi and a great view.
Since we were there in ... the middle of winter, of course not all shops open. However I would the place almost as second Las Vegas describe. There is so much to do, shopping, food etc. the hotel was in a very good location. We could walk everywhere. About five minutes down the hill, you get to the falls.
There is a parking lot, but is expensive again. CAD 20 $per day. Directly across the street at the casino hotel there is cheaper parking spaces: 5 $CAD per day and there is a direct link from the Hilton.
The breakfast was fantastic. There was everything the heart could desire. Different kinds of bread and bread rolls, cold cuts verschiener, (including salami, which are unusual is), scrambled eggs, fried eggs, sausage, bacon and so on could by a chef in a unique scrambled eggs cooked, for example with vegetables, cheese or bacon. Everything was prepared fresh. There were different juices and different coffee varieties.
It is a very good hotel. Per night we paid 60 €(for both) included breakfast.
Please note, this hotel is located on the Canadian side of Niagara Falls. I would really recommend this site also, because from the American side you don't see as much and there is no attractions. Drive so better on the Canadian side. Where you in the other in Canadian dollars (CAD). American dollars, but lower exchange rate. So either will pick you up your money, exchanges, or pay the best everything with credit card. We also did that and was the best solution. Otherwise you're on the border your passport and give ticket from ' meters by plane ready to enter appearance, if you by car from the US to Canada drive. The entry is however no problem.
In the place Niagara Falls there is a small outlet-shopping center. It was to be recommended.
Otherwise I have the tip for you: if you want to go there from somewhere else, choose the airport buffalo in the United States. They are about 1 hour drive from Niagara Falls in Canada nor buffalo in USA. The is the cheapest. Toronto is very expensive for the airport tax. This is in buffalo not.
